WebMay 15, 2000 · Experimental results in the machining of a SiC-reinforced aluminum metal–matrix composite (MMC) with diamond inserts are presented in this paper. MMCs are very difficult to machine and diamond tools are considered by far the best choice for the machining of these materials. WebWhat is the advantage of The PCD diamond inserts cutting tool? A. Longer tool life. Due to the very high hardness of the PCD diamond, the PCD tool life can exceed carbide cutting tool life 50 to 100 times in certain applications. B. Higher machining efficiency.
